Quick context for reviewers: conflicts arise when an event is edited on two replicas before reconciliation; we apply last-writer-wins with a tombstone grace window, which has security implications around event-visibility leaks during merge. Threat-model notes live in `docs/threats.md`. Please don't file findings against the legacy resolver — it's slated for removal. All conflict-resolution logic, including the merge policy, is owned by the engineer named below.

named custodian: Holael Lamwyn

Facilities Ticket — Cleaning Crew Access, Brindle Annex

For new starters handling evening lock-up: the Sorano Cleaning crew arrives nightly at 21:30 via the annex side door. Check their rota sheet, note arrival in the log, and ensure the storeroom is relocked afterward. To let them through the side door, enter the access code below.

badge for yaweg-hafog: bdg-GX-6

Handover note — Docstraight linter service (Marit → on-call)

Before my rotation ends: the documentation linter is mid-upgrade to the new rule engine, so both rule sets are loaded and the legacy one wins on conflict. If the nightly run stalls, restart the worker pool rather than the whole service; a full restart drops the rule cache and takes twenty minutes to warm. Nothing else is fragile right now. The active runtime configuration you will want on hand is as follows.

settings of tagef-bawif:
DRUIX_HOST=druix.zemvarlabs.internal
DRUIX_PORT=8000

Action item PM-114 (Tallowbird stale-cache incident): plugin authors must call the new invalidation hook instead of relying on TTL expiry. Plugins that skip the hook will be delisted from the Tallowbird registry after the next release. Deadline is end of quarter. Migration steps and sample code are documented on the internal page.

runbook for badug-kadup: https://confluence.zemvarlabs.internal/projects/browse/display/projects/bd1b